Friday in the Second Week of Advent
Isaiah 48:17-19

Thus says the LORD, your redeemer,
the Holy One of Israel:
I, the LORD, your God,
teach you what is for your good,
and lead you on the way you should go.
If you would hearken to my commandments,
your prosperity would be like a river,
and your vindication like the waves of the sea;
Your descendants would be like the sand,
and those born of your stock like its grains,
Their name never cut off
or blotted out from my presence.

Dawg's thought:

Today's prayer intention is for those who have been affected by the storms in the Pacific Northwest.

I can admit it: it's hard to trust God. Outside the realm of the happy sentiments, it's a struggle everyday to remember that God is truly taking care of us.

In our own times of struggle, we must always remember that God is teaching us what is our good and leading us to where we should go. It is only our free will that can get in the way of the plans God has in store for us. Take care and God Bless.
